Grant in Aid Program 2027 (Maryland)

Dated: November 11, 2025

The Harford County Department of Housing and Community Services is proud to announce the 2027 Grant in Aid Program.

Donor Name: Harford County Department of Housing and Community Services

State: Maryland

County: Harford County (MD)

Type of Grant: Grant

Deadline: 12/08/2025

Size of the Grant: $1000 to $10,000

Grant Duration: 1 Year

Details:

The Harford County Department of Housing and Community Services fosters sustainable communities by coordinating with municipalities, public and private agencies, civic organizations, and community members to target resources to public service needs in community. Grant In Aid administers grants to public service organizations serving at risk populations, low-income households those  at risk of homelessness, individuals with differing abilities, disadvantaged youth, senior citizens and the recovery community.

To carry out its mission, Housing and Community Services awards operating and project grants to qualified organizations. The Housing & Community Services grant process is reviewed by the Community Services Review Board comprised of citizen volunteers representing a cross section of the County’s population.

Grant-in-Aid is available to eligible nonprofit organizations that can

  • Provide housing and homeless services to Harford County citizens
  • Strive to meet the emergency and daily needs of Harford County citizens and impacted neighborhoods including at risk populations, individuals with differing abilities, disadvantaged youth, senior citizens and the recovery community.

Funding Information

Limit for first-time applicants is $5,000.

Eligible Activities

Eligible Activities include:

  • Activities serving low-income Harford County residents who are homeless or at risk of becoming homeless.
  • Activities that can be accomplished during a 12-month period, including operating funds.
  • Activities that immediately improve participants’ quality of life and/or assist them in improving and stabilizing their quality of life in the future.
  • Activities that support the Harford County Consolidated Plan.

Eligible Funding Items Include:

  • Salaries – Employee wages; administrative salary costs to be limited to 25% of total program budget
  • Fringe Benefits – Social Security, retirement, insurance, worker’s compensation
  • Contractual – Rent, lease of office equipment and building space, utilities, telephone, high speed internet services, advertising, general liability, unemployment insurance, professional services (legal, audit/financial, etc.), service and maintenance contracts (office equipment, building and custodial services, data processing hardware, consultants, etc.)
  • Supplies/Materials – General office supplies, printing, postage and delivery, janitorial supplies, food, small tools (hammers, etc.) audio/visual equipment, computer supplies and software, printer cartridges, paper, etc.
  • Business/Travel – Mileage, parking, tolls, commercial carrier/transportation costs, meals and lodging, professional books and periodicals, membership fees, training/seminar tuition, etc.

Eligibility Criteria

Qualifying applicants must:

  • Be incorporated as a non-profit, tax-exempt 501(c)(3) organization
  • Primarily serve low- to moderate-income individuals/households and be able to document who is served
  • Serve homeless, those at risk of homeless, and/or provide affordable housing
  • Serve at risk populations including: low-income households, individuals with differing abilities, disadvantaged youth, senior citizens and the recovery community.
  • Be soundly managed, financially accountable and provide proof thereof (professional audit required)
  • Hold activities in spaces available to the disabled
  • Meet the needs of the visually and hearing impaired, upon notification of need
